So what is asset lifecycle management?
Asset lifecycle management is about getting the most out of your facilities and equipment. It enables you to reduce cost and risk through comprehensive operational and financial planning for the lifetime of the asset. This begins at design and construction, proceeds to operations and maintenance and finally results in decommissioning or replacement of the asset.
Asset lifecycle management is of particular importance to centrally funded organisations that must create comprehensively documented forward financial plans in order to receive the appropriate budgets each year.
Couple that with frameworks that require strict compliance and reporting and you find managing the asset lifecycle can become one of the biggest headaches for facilities managers.

Skyline

The Skyline forecast module performs analytics over the base asset information such as installation date, life expectancy, criticality, current condition, replacement costs to forecast the cost of sustaining those assets over a defined period.
It includes functions to support and predict the interventions that will be required to sustain a defined minimum level of service, be that appearance, function or criticality.
Equaliser
The Equaliser module allows the user to defer, or advance, the predicted interventions to create a plan that satisfies both funding constraints and risk.
The user will be able to select assets by location or by function and adjust their point of intervention with a simple slider. Moving an intervention will dynamically alter the financial forecast skyline and flag if the deferral presents an unacceptable level of risk.
